Ingredients
To make these delicious Crispy Air Fryer Apple Fries, you will need the following ingredients:
For the Apple Fries
- 2 large apples (Granny Smith, Honeycrisp, or your favorite variety)
- 1/2 cup all-purpose flour
- 2 large eggs, beaten
- 1 cup panko breadcrumbs (or regular breadcrumbs)
- 2 teaspoons cinnamon
- 2 tablespoons granulated sugar
- Cooking spray
For the Dipping Sauce
- 1/2 cup caramel sauce (optional)
- 1/2 cup vanilla yogurt (optional for a lighter option)
How to Make Crispy Air Fryer Apple Fries
Step 1: Prepare the Apples
Start by peeling the apples if desired. Slice them into wedges about 1/2 inch thick. Be sure to remove the core and seeds. In a small bowl, mix together the cinnamon and sugar; set aside.
Step 2: Set Up the Breading Station
Create three bowls: one for flour, one for beaten eggs, and one for panko breadcrumbs. In the breadcrumb bowl, mix half of the cinnamon-sugar mixture into the breadcrumbs.
Step 3: Coat the Apple Slices
Dredge each apple slice in flour, shaking off any excess. Dip it into the beaten egg, ensuring it is fully coated. Press each slice into the breadcrumb mixture until evenly coated. Repeat this process with all apple slices.
Step 4: Air Fry
Preheat your air fryer to 375°F (190°C) for about 3 minutes. Arrange breaded apple slices in a single layer within the air fryer basket. Lightly spray slices with cooking spray. Air fry for 8 to 10 minutes, flipping halfway through until they are golden brown and crispy.
Step 5: Serve
Once cooked, sprinkle remaining cinnamon-sugar mixture on top while still hot. Serve immediately with caramel sauce or vanilla yogurt for dipping. Enjoy your delicious Crispy Air Fryer Apple Fries!

How to Perfect Crispy Air Fryer Apple Fries
To achieve the best results with your Crispy Air Fryer Apple Fries, consider these simple tips for success.
- Boldly Season: Don’t hesitate to adjust the cinnamon and sugar ratio according to your taste preferences for optimal flavor.
- Choose Firm Apples: Use firmer apple varieties like Granny Smith or Honeycrisp to maintain structure during cooking.
- Avoid Overcrowding: Arrange apple slices in a single layer in the air fryer basket to ensure even cooking and crispiness.
- Preheat Properly: Preheating your air fryer ensures a consistent cooking temperature, leading to perfectly crispy fries.
- Monitor Cooking Time: Keep an eye on the fries while they cook; flipping them halfway helps achieve uniform browning.
- Experiment with Spices: Consider adding nutmeg or pumpkin spice for a unique twist on traditional flavors.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
Avoiding common mistakes can help you achieve the best results with your Crispy Air Fryer Apple Fries.
- Using the Wrong Apple Variety: Not all apples are created equal. Choose crisp and firm varieties like Granny Smith or Honeycrisp for the best texture and flavor.
- Skipping the Coating Process: Failing to properly coat the apple slices can lead to soggy fries. Make sure to dredge, dip, and coat them thoroughly for that perfect crunch.
- Overcrowding the Air Fryer Basket: Placing too many apple slices in the basket can prevent even cooking. Air fry in batches to ensure each slice gets crispy.
- Not Preheating the Air Fryer: Skipping preheating may result in uneven cooking. Always preheat your air fryer for a few minutes before adding your apple fries.
- Ignoring Cooking Times: Each air fryer varies, so keep an eye on your apple fries. Cooking them for too long can make them tough instead of tender inside.

Storage & Reheating Instructions
Refrigerator Storage
- Store leftover apple fries in an airtight container.
- They will last for up to 3 days in the refrigerator.
Freezing Crispy Air Fryer Apple Fries
- Allow the apple fries to cool completely before freezing.
- Place them in a single layer on a baking sheet, freeze until solid, then transfer to a freezer-safe bag. They can be frozen for up to 2 months.
Reheating Crispy Air Fryer Apple Fries
- Oven: Preheat to 375°F (190°C) and bake for about 5-7 minutes until heated through.
- Microwave: Heat on high for 30 seconds at a time until warm; this may make them soft rather than crispy.
- Stovetop: Reheat in a skillet over medium heat for about 3-5 minutes, turning occasionally to retain some crispiness.
Frequently Asked Questions
If you have any questions about making Crispy Air Fryer Apple Fries, we’ve got you covered!
How do I make Crispy Air Fryer Apple Fries healthier?
You can reduce sugar by adjusting the amount used in the cinnamon-sugar mixture or opting for a natural sweetener.
Can I use other fruits instead of apples?
Yes! Pears or peaches can also work well with this recipe. Just adjust cooking times as needed.
What dipping sauces pair well with Crispy Air Fryer Apple Fries?
Caramel sauce is popular, but you can also serve them with honey, maple syrup, or flavored yogurt.
Why are my apple fries not crispy?
This could be due to overcrowding the air fryer or not coating them adequately. Ensure they have enough space and are evenly coated before cooking.
